Some of these words cannot be “sounded out” using phonetic principles. These are words that are so common that children should learn to quickly recognize them by sight, rather than ‘sounding them out’. Whereas, Fry categorized his words based on frequency, e.g. Dolch Words are the most frequently used words in the English language, making up 50 to 70 percent of any text Many of the Dolch words cannot be 'sounded out' and must be learned by 'sight,' or memorized. Dolch categorized his words based on grades: pre-primer (PP), primer, 1st, 2nd and 3rd grade. 100 Must know Kindergarten English words for your kid.
